Vice President Mr. Dong Zhixiong Attending the Fourth ASEAN-China Business Council (ACBC) Meeting

On Oct. 18, the Fourth ASEAN-China Business Council (ACBC) Meeting was held in Nanning with the theme of “Mutual Discussion on Harmonious Development, Further Promotion for Common Richness”. The chairman of CCPIT, head of the Chinese delegation Mr. Wan Jifei and president of ASEAN-Chambers of Commerce and Industry (ASEAN-CCI), head of the ASEAN delegation Mr. Freddy Lam Fong Loi delivered speeches. Nearly 100 chamber and enterprise representatives from China, Thailand, Malaysia, Indonesia, Vietnam, Laos, Singapore and Brunei attended the meeting. The Nanning Joint Declaration by National Chambers of Commerce and Industry of China and ASEAN countries was discussed and issued at the event. Participants agreed to promote long term, stable and sustainable cooperative relationships, guided by the principles of equality, mutual benefit, enterprise orientation and common development in a voluntary, diversified, constant and deepening cooperating way, according to the declaration.Vice president Mr. Dong Zhixiong attended the meeting and delivered a speech upon invitation. He introduced the developing history and situation of Sinosteel’s business in ASEAN and expressed the wish to actively participate China-ASEAN economic and trade cooperation, consolidate bilateral resource exploration, promote economic and technological communication and provide good and specialized service.

In order to promote economic cooperation, trade as well as investment between China and ASEAN countries, China Council for the Promotion of International Trade (CCPIT) and ASEAN Chamber of Commerce and Industry (ACCI) have signed in 1997 a Memorandum of Understanding on establishing ASEAN-China Business Council. ASEAN-China Business Council is composed of leaders of China Chamber of International Commerce, ASEAN Chamber of Commerce and Industry, National Chambers of Commerce of ASEAN member countries as well as renowned business leaders of each country. Till now members from the Chinese side include: Sinosteel Corporation, CITIC, Haier Group, ZTE Corporation, China National Petroleum Corporation, China Construction Bank, China Electric Power Technology Imp. & Exp. Corp., etc.

The ASEAN-China Business Council was established on November 8, 2001. The first three plenary sessions are: the first held Nov. of 2001 in Jakarta, Indonesia; the second in Dec. 2003 in Kunming, China; the third in June of 2004 in Rangoon, Burma. It is decided that the fifth plenary session will be held in Chiang Mai, Thailand.    

ASEAN-China Business Council aims at promoting ASEAN-China Free Trade Area, communicating governments with enterprises, promoting the co-development of nations’ economies. It plays a very active role in promoting China-ASEAN economic cooperation.
